How to Install a Bathtub Yourself
Installing a bathtub isn't precisely brain surgery, but it does need strong plumbing, carpentry, as well as occasionally, tiling skills. Replacing an old bath tub with a new one is likewise a reasonably difficult project. If the old bathtub is conveniently accessible, the job can relocate quickly; if you have to open up a wall surface to remove the old tub and also position the new tub, the job is much harder. In either situation, the job is within a residence handyman's skills, although you will certainly need a helper to leave the old bathtub and also embeded in the brand-new one. Make sure you have qualified yourself for the task as well as fit trying it. As opposed to working with a contractor to take over a halfway-completed project, it is better to consider employing one before you begin. Possibilities are you may need an expert plumber to make tube connections.
This article will aid you mount a brand-new tub in your shower room if you have actually already purchased a new bathtub as well as don't need to alter the arrangement of your previous supply of water pipes.

  • Planning for the Setup


    First of all, the supporting frame provided with the bathroom must be fitted (if called for) according to the supplier's guidelines. Next off, fit the taps or mixer to the bathtub. When suitable the faucet block, it is very important to make certain that if the tap comes with a plastic washing machine, it is fitted in between the bath and the taps. On a plastic bath, it is additionally reasonable to fit a supporting plate under the taps device to stop stress on the bathtub.
    Fit the adaptable faucet ports to the bottom of the two faucets utilizing 2 nuts and olives (occasionally provided with the tub). Fit the plug-hole electrical outlet by smearing mastic filler round the sink electrical outlet hole, and then pass the electrical outlet with the hole in the bath. Make use of the nut supplied by the maker to fit the plug-hole. Analyze the plug-hole electrical outlet for an inlet on the side for the overflow pipeline.
    Next, fit completion of the versatile overflow pipe to the overflow electrical outlet. After that, screw the pipeline to the overflow face which ought to be fitted inside the bath. Make certain you use every one of the provided washers.
    Connect the catch to the bottom of the waste electrical outlet on the bathtub by winding the string of the waste outlet with silicone mastic or PTFE tape, and also screw on the trap to the outlet. Link the bottom of the overflow tube in a similar manner.The bathroom ought to currently be ready to be suited its final placement.

    Removing Old Taps


    If you require to replace old faucets with new ones as a part of your installment, then the first thing you need to do is disconnect the water. After doing so, switch on the faucets to drain any kind of water continuing to be in the system. The process of getting rid of the existing taps can be rather problematic because of the limited accessibility that is typically the instance.
    Use a container wrench (crowsfoot spanner) or a faucet tool to reverse the nut that connects the supply pipelines to the faucets. Have a cloth all set for the remaining water that will certainly originate from the pipes. When the supply pipes have been gotten rid of, use the exact same device to loosen the nut that holds the taps onto the bath/basin. You will certainly need to stop the solitary faucets from turning throughout this procedure. Once the taps have actually been removed, the holes in the bath/basin will need to be cleaned of any type of old securing compound.
    Prior to going on to fit the new taps, contrast the pipeline links on the old taps to the new faucets. If the old taps are longer than the new taps, after that a shank adapter is needed for the new taps to fit.

    Installing the Bathtub


    Utilizing both wood boards under its feet, place the tub in the called for placement. The wooden boards are valuable in equally spreading out the weight of the bathtub over the area of the boards rather than focusing all the weight onto four tiny factors.
    The next goal is to make certain that the bathtub is leveled all round. This can be accomplished by checking the spirit level and adjusting the feet on the bathtub up until the level checks out level.
    To set up faucets, fit all-time low of the furthest flexible tap port to the proper supply pipeline by making a compression sign up with; after that do the very same for the various other tap.
    Activate the water and check all joints and new pipework for leaks and tighten them if required. Fill the bathtub and also inspect the overflow outlet as well as the typical outlet for leaks.
    Lastly, repair the bath paneling as described in the producer's instruction manual. Tiling and sealing around the bathtub should wait till the tub has actually been utilized a minimum of once as this will settle it into its last placement.

    Suitable New Touches


    If the tails of the new taps are plastic, then you will require a plastic adapter to stop damages to the thread. One end of the connector fits on the plastic tail of the tap and the various other end supplies a link to the existing supply pipes.
    If you need to fit a monobloc, after that you will certainly need decreasing couplers, which connects the 10mm pipeline of the monobloc to the typical 15mm supply pipeline.
    Next, position the faucet in the placing opening in the bath/basin guaranteeing that the washers remain in area in between the tap and the sink. Safeguard the faucet in place with the maker offered backnut. Once the faucet is safely in place, the supply pipelines can be attached to the tails of the taps. The taps can either be attached by utilizing corrugated copper piping or with normal faucet ports. The former kind must be linked to the tap finishes initially, tightening up only by hand. The supply pipelines can later on be connected to the various other end. Tighten up both ends with a spanner after both ends have been attached.

    Tiling Around the Tub


    In the area where the bathroom satisfies the floor tile, it is needed to seal the joins with a silicone rubber caulking. This is important as the installation can move sufficient to split a rigid seal, creating the water to permeate the wall surface in between the bath and also the tiling, resulting in difficulties with moisture and feasible leaks to the ceiling listed below.
    You can choose from a range of coloured sealants to assimilate your fixtures as well as fittings. They are marketed in tubes and cartridges, and also are capable of securing gaps approximately a width of 3mm (1/8 inch). If you have a bigger gap to fill up, you can fill it with twists of drenched newspaper or soft rope. Bear in mind to always load the bathtub with water prior to sealing, to enable the activity experienced when the tub remains in use. The sealer can crack relatively very early if you do not consider this activity before securing.
    Alternatively, ceramic coving or quadrant tiles can be made use of to edge the bath or shower tray. Plastic strips of coving, which are easy to use and also cut to size, are additionally easily offered on the marketplace. It is recommended to fit the floor tiles using water-resistant or water-proof adhesive as well as cement.

    Install Piping Before Tub


    You will be using your existing drain and waste vent system, but pipes required include the hot and cold water supply lines and a pipe leading to a shower head. A mixing valve and shower head are also needed. Air chambers may be required.


    Position the Tub


    Lower the tub into place so that the continuous flange fits against the wall studs and rests on 1’x4' or 2’x4' supports. Anchor the tub to the enclosure with nails or screws inserted through the flanges into the studs.



    NOTE: Remember, bathtubs and shower stalls may require support framing. A bathtub filled with water is extremely heavy, so check building codes and framing support before installing the tub.


    Assemble Drain Connections


    Assemble the bathtub drain connections by connecting the tub overflow with the tub drain above the trap, not beyond it. The trap will have a compression fitting that screws over the arm of the overflow assembly.


    Place a Pipe For the Shower Head


    First, locate a brass female threaded winged fitting and attach it to a framing support via a screw or a nail. Then run a pipe up the wall for the shower head. Sweat or solder the other side of the brass fitting to the top of the pipe.


    Attaching Hot and Cold Water Lines


    Attach your water lines for both hot and cold by sweating these directly into the hot and cold ports of the mixing valve. The mixing valve will be how water enters the tub’s system, not by the pipes themselves.


    Install the Spout


    Extend a piece of 1/2 inch pipe, or whichever length is specified in the manufacturer’s instructions, for the tub spout. Sweat on a male threaded fitting at the end of the pipe or use a brass nipple of the proper length and a 1/2 inch cap.



    NOTE: At this point you should have your rough-in plumbing work inspected before proceeding further.


    Check For Leaks


    Restore the water pressure and check the drain connection and the supply pipes for any sign of leaking.


    estore the Bathroom Wall


    Replace the wall with moisture-resistant drywall as a base for your wall covering. Seal the joints between the wall and your new tub with silicone caulk as protection against water seepage.
